Jet offers some form of Trip Insurance - is that worth taking?

On Kingfisher, the roundtrip including layovers adds up to 9h50m, for a cost of 9866 INR.

On Jet, the roundtrip including layovers adds up to 8h30m, for a cost of 11766 INR. Trip Insurance is an addl 149 INR per pax.

It would appear Jet via BOM would be the better alternative considering time. However, that can easily be lost if BOM congestion is anything like JFK/LGA/EWR congestion.

One last note, the Jet fare is some kind of deeply discounted fare called "Special Fare (No Refund)". The other fare classes are titled "Check Fare (restricted)", "Check Fares" (am excluding the refundable/changeable fares - assuming that's something like a Y or B on UA).
